Episode 9 - Coach Mark Potter (Escaping the Pit)
7/18/2018
Mark Potter ( https://www.d2up.org/ ) was a head men's basketball coach for 30 years. He recently left the coaching profession to pursue his passion for educating and motivating people from all occupations. Potter speaks on many topics including motivation and mental toughness, but his greatest passion lies in his personal battle with severe depression.
Twelve years ago, Potter knew something wasn't right and he began a downward spiral into a world of darkness. Since that time, he has been on a crusade to educate people about depression and encourage others suffering from mental illness to seek assistance. His passion is to share his story in hopes that people will pursue treatment and find a way to live productively with mental illness.
